#e5d980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5d980 is composed of 89.8% red, 85.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 52.9 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 70%. #e5d980 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cbb301.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#e5d980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5d980 has RGB values of R:229, G:217,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.44,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15063424.

Shades and Tints of #e5d980
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e5d980
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b5af is the less saturated color, while #fdeb68 is the most saturated one.
